the person at a CASS large firm (such as a custodian or prime broker) who is designated as having responsibility for the CASS operational oversight function (known colloquially as the firm’s “CF10a”).
For more information see the FCA handbook: SUP Chapter 10A.9R. A person likely to be of a nervous disposition, even if she wasn't before she became the firm’s CF10a.
